The playoffs are.. off! in the 2015 IIHF Women’s World Championship

Damhockey

The playoffs have started in the 2015 IIHF Women’s World Championship in Malmö, Sweden. Canada and team USA qualified directly to the semifinals from group A. USA won the group, beating Canada 4-2 in the group final. Finland placed third and met Switzerland in the quarterfinal, beating the Swiss 3-0. The other quarterfinal is played right now between Sweden who won group B, against Russia who finished last in group A. The standing is 0-0. The winner between the two teams will face USA in the semifinal. Finland will face Canada.

In 2014 no top-level tournament was played in the women’s hockey beside the olympic games in Sochi. Teams not invited to the olympics played a minor tournament. Canada won the olympic gold, beating USA in the final just like they did in the 2013 World Championships. Chances are that the teams will face each other in the final this year as well since the European teams haven’t kept up with the North Atlantic dominance. Sweden beat USA in the 2006 olympic semifinal but since then, USA and Canada has won all gold and silver medals in the major tournaments. Hopefully this will change soon since the sport needs competition. This year, however, we bet that USA will win the gold and Canada the silver. If Sweden beat Russia, maybe they can use the home team advantage and beat Finland in the bronze medal game. Sweden got a rough start to the tournament when they lost against Japan who got their first championship victory ever. Since then the Swedes beat Switzerland and Germany and made it to the quarter final.
